Churchill rout Shillong Lajong

Duler (Goa): Churchill Brothers scored a resounding 6-0 win over Shillong Lajong to move to the top of the table with a two-point lead over Pune FC and Dempo in the 14th round I-League clash at Duler Stadium here on Friday.

With defending champions Dempo succumbing to Prayag United, Churchill find themselves at the top with 28 points from 11 matches, with another match in hand.

Shillong Lajong remained at 13 points from 14 matches.

Churchill, who drubbed Sporting Clube de Goa 8-4 in their last match, scored through Steven Dias, Henri Arnaud, Ajay Singh and Beto substitute Akram Moghrabi’s brace.

They found the going tough on the astro turf in the first half, but goals in a space of two minutes by Steven Dias(40th) and Henri Antchouet (42th) saw the end of the rival challenge as Churchill pumped in four more goals in the second half.

Churchill’s opening goal came in the 40th minute when a long ball from Bilal Najjarine was trapped nicely by Steven Dias and finished off coolly from inside the six yard box. Two minutes later it was 2-0 as Raju Yumnan found Henri inside the heart of the Lajong danger zone and the Gabonese striker was presented with a simple finish. Dinesh Balan, the hero in the last match, pulled a hamstring and was replaced by Ajay Singh who made it 3-0 when he brilliantly met the ball with a header off a cross from the right by Roberto Silva. Meanwhile Lajong had to bring in Jacob for Nigerian striker Friday, who picked up an injury in the 30th minute, to add to the ever-growing injury list of the Reds. Churchill substitute striker Akram Moghrabi, who replaced Henri, soon scored a brace. He headed into an open goal after being fed by Raju in the 66th minute, and in the 73rd he was in the act again, beating the offside trap.

Man of the Match Beto had the final say when his curling effort from outside the box found the top corner of the nets.

United SC stun Dempo

Big-spending United SC gave a big blow to Dempo’s title aspiration with a 1-0 upset win over the defending champions in a round 14 I-League match.

Costa Rican World Cupper Carlos Hernandez scored the all-important goal in the 89th minute to give United SC a winning start to the New Year and final phase of the I-League.

Dempo were reduced to 10 players in the 85th minute when their left back Debabrata Roy earned his second yellow card for a bad tackle to United SC midfielder Shankar Oraon. (PTI)
